I have upgraded from 2.2.7 to 2.2-stable.
I do cvsup 2.2-stable and make buildworld  and get ERROR
/new/usr/src/gnu/usr.bin/gperf/../../../contrib/gperf/src/new.cc:80:
warning: `c
atch', `throw', and `try' are all C++ reserved words
/new/usr/src/gnu/usr.bin/gperf/../../../contrib/gperf/src/new.cc: In
function `v
oid operator delete(void *)':
/new/usr/src/gnu/usr.bin/gperf/../../../contrib/gperf/src/new.cc:82:
declaration
 of `operator delete(void *)' throws different exceptions...
<internal>:82: ...from previous declaration here
*** Error code 1

Stop.
What must I do ?
